Transaction 3813515a1f24ebe02f3d6ad22757d83d31acbb8e8c27773f69b7b5a906254c0c
1 Input
1 Output
-
3813515a1f24ebe02f3d6ad22757d83d31acbb8e8c27773f69b7b5a906254c0c:0
- value
- 5022734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5b1526515dd5c13bda37ae09b3e68104c28b92d OP_EQUAL
- address
- 3MAvGwbWEvF18V2kPxn1Jw4LyvhKLD56fv